Protocol summary

Study aim
Determining the effect of Vitamin D and oral Calcium on bone density in children with leukemia.
Design
This study is a triple blind controlled clinical trial with parallel group design. The randomization method will be simple randomization. Each group includes 66 patients. In the intervention group vitamin D and calcium supplements are given in addition to common treatments.
Settings and conduct
This study will be conducted at Amir Kabir Hospital in Arak. For all patients with acute lymphoblastic leukemia (ALL), bone mineral density (BMD) and serum level of ALKP, P, Ca, 25OH D3 will be measured at baseline. Then the patients will randomly enter into two groups. In intervention group, patients receive calcium, 30-40 mg/kg per day and vitamin D, 400 units per day in addition to Chemotherapy and patients in the other group only receive chemotherapy. Six months after the start of the treatment, BMD and serum markers will be remeasured. This study is triple blind and clinical care providers, Researchers and Data analyzer will be kept blind to the grouping.
Participants/Inclusion and excl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: Children with acute lymphoblastic leukemia; being at the age of over 5 years old. Exclusion criteria: Patients with no compliance with the supplements; Patients with no satisfaction to continue the study؛ no compliance in the use of enteric supplements؛ Patients who don't have bone marrow densitometry.
Intervention groups
Patients are assigned randomly into two groups, and in the intervention group in addition to chemotherapy drugs, we add calcium and vitamin D supplements.
Main outcome variables
Bone mineral density
